The Mixed Kuper-Camassa-Holm-Hunter-Saxton Equations
Ling Zhang, Beibei Hu
Pages: 179 - 187
In this paper, a mixed Kuper-CH-HS equation by a Kupershmidt deformation is introduced and its integrable properties are studied. Moreover, that the equation can be viewed as a constraint Hamiltonian flow on the coadjoint orbit of Neveu-Schwarz superalgebra is shown.
